[1.187.205] No Tracers/Sound On Modded Turret While MP Client

Meridius_IX shared this bug 5 years ago
Not a Bug

It appears there's a bug with modded turrets and their tracer/audio not triggering for clients in multiplayer. In our own tests, we determined its affecting modded turrets that use the MissileTurret as the base of their turret (so they do not require the spinning barrel subpart). It only seems to appear on turrets using tracer bullets - turrets using missile projectiles do not appear to have the issue.

In the DS, the audio/visual doesn't appear for the suspect turrets, however they still apply damage as normal.

Hello, Engineers!

After programmers took a closer look on this issue, it turned out that the issue is not on our side, but the mod is not written correctly. This said mod is using wrong base class (MySmallMissileLauncher), which is not supporting projectiles.

Please let the owner of the mod know that he should try to use MySmallGatlingGun base class instead. That one should work.

Will close this thread as not a bug, as there is nothing more to be done on our side. The mod creator is responsible for correct mod behavior. We do not provide support for mods, only to base game.
